Web10 mrt. 2024 · For example, if you put $1,000 into a newly opened brokerage account, and a stock you want to own trades for $50, you have the ability to buy as many as 20 shares. … WebFor example, let's say a company has 100 shares outstanding, and an investor owns ten shares or 10% of the company's stock. If the company issues 100 additional new shares, the investor now has 5% ownership of the company's stock since the investor owns five shares out of 200. Web9 dec. 2015 · One single share must be issued when a private limited company is incorporated with Companies House. There is no limitation to the number of shares a company can issue during or after incorporation, except there is a provision of authorised share capital stated in the articles of association. WebWhile there is no limit on the number of shares a company can have, there is a limit on the number of shareholders a private company can have. A private company should not have more than 50 shareholders. How To Issue Shares. The way a company issues shares will depend on both their governing documents and the Corporations Act 2001.
